Man found dead in Fairfax Co. apartment had been shot

WASHINGTON — Police have identified a man found dead from a gunshot wound in a Fairfax County apartment Tuesday afternoon.

Fairfax County Fire and Rescue responded to the 5500 block of Seminary Road in Alexandria, Virginia, at about 2:30 p.m. for reports of an unresponsive man in an apartment. Police found a man who had an apparent gunshot wound and was dead.

Police have identified the victim as 35-year-old Babtunde Fadahunsi.

Police say they have reason to believe it was not a “random event.” Detectives are continuing to investigate, and say there is currently no suspect information.
